About Tetris

Tetris is the puzzle game everything else gets compared to. Pieces made of four squares fall one at a time. You move and rotate each one so that it fits the pile below, and any full horizontal line vanishes, scoring points and making room. The pile grows faster as the level rises, and the game ends when new pieces have nowhere to spawn.

This browser version keeps the essentials: the seven standard pieces, a preview of the next piece, a hold slot, hard drop and a rising speed curve. It is simple to start and endlessly deep, which is why it has survived for decades.

How to Play Tetris

  1. Watch the falling piece and the next-piece preview.
  2. Move the piece left or right and rotate it to fit the stack.
  3. Complete full lines to clear them; four at once is a Tetris.
  4. Keep the stack low and play as long as you can.

Controls

  • Left and right arrow keys: move.
  • Up arrow: rotate. Some versions also use Z and X.
  • Down arrow: soft drop. Space: hard drop.
  • C or Shift: hold the current piece.

Tips and Tricks

  • Keep the stack flat and leave one column open for the long I piece.
  • Use the hold slot to save an I piece for a four-line clear.
  • Do not bury holes. One covered gap costs more than a slow placement.
  • Look at the next piece before you decide where the current one goes.

Tetris FAQ

How do you score a Tetris?

Clear four lines with a single vertical I piece. It is worth far more than four separate single-line clears.

Does the game get faster?

Yes. Every ten lines raises the level, and pieces fall faster.

Can I play with a touchscreen?

Yes, with on-screen buttons, although a keyboard is more precise.
